What is Cosmetology

esthetics facial toners in Lisbon NH salonCosmetology is a profession that is everything about making the human body look more beautiful with the use of cosmetics. So of course it makes sense that numerous cosmetology schools are described as beauty schools. Most of us think of makeup when we hear the word cosmetics, but basically a cosmetic may be anything that enhances the appearance of a person’s skin, hair or nails. In order to work as a cosmetologist, most states mandate that you go through some kind of specialized training and then be licensed. Once licensed, the work environments include not only Lisbon NH beauty salons and barber shops, but also such places as spas, hotels and resorts. Many cosmetologists, once they have acquired experience and a customer base, open their own shops or salons. Others will begin servicing clients either in their own homes or will travel to the client’s house, or both. Cosmetology college graduates go by many titles and are employed in a wide variety of specialties including:

Esthetician Certificates and Degrees

cucumber mask Lisbon NH esthetics clientThere are essentially two options available to receive esthetician training and a credential upon completion. You can enroll in a certificate (or diploma) program, or you can work toward an Associate’s degree. Certificate programs normally call for 12 to 18 months to complete, while an Associate’s degree usually takes about 2 years. If you enroll in a certificate program you will be trained in all of the major areas of cosmetology. Briefer programs are available if you prefer to specialize in just one area, for instance esthetics. A degree program will also most likely include management and marketing training to ensure that graduates are better prepared to operate a parlor or other Lisbon NH business. More advanced degrees are not common, but Bachelor and Master’s degree programs are offered in such areas as salon or spa management. Whatever type of training program you decide on, it’s essential to make certain that it’s recognized by the New Hampshire Board of Cosmetology. Numerous states only approve schools that are accredited by certain highly regarded organizations, such as the American Association of Cosmetology Schools (AACS). Online Esthetician Programs

Online esthetician schools are convenient for Lisbon NH students who are employed full time and have family responsibilities that make it challenging to attend a more traditional school. There are many web-based beauty school programs offered that can be accessed through a home computer or laptop at the student’s convenience. More traditional beauty programs are typically fast paced since many programs are as short as six or eight months. This means that a significant portion of time is spent in the classroom. With online courses, you are covering the same amount of material, but you are not devoting numerous hours away from your home or travelling to and from classes. However, it’s important that the program you pick can provide internship training in nearby salons and parlors so that you also receive the hands-on training required for a complete education. Without the internship part of the training, it’s impossible to acquire the skills required to work in any area of the cosmetology field. So don’t forget if you choose to enroll in an online program to confirm that internship training is available in your area.

Is the School Accredited? It’s important to make sure that the esthetician school you enroll in is accredited. The accreditation should be by a U.S. Department of Education acknowledged local or national organization, such as the National Accrediting Commission for Cosmetology Arts & Sciences (NACCAS). Programs accredited by the NACCAS must meet their high standards ensuring a superior curriculum and education. Accreditation may also be essential for getting student loans or financial aid, which typically are not obtainable in 03585 for non- accredited schools. It’s also a prerequisite for licensing in some states that the training be accredited. And as a final benefit, numerous Lisbon NH businesses will not recruit recent graduates of non-accredited schools, or may look more favorably upon individuals with accredited training.

    Lisbon, New Hampshire

    The primary settlement in town, where 980 people resided at the 2010 census,[1] is defined as the Lisbon census-designated place (CDP) and is located along U.S. Route 302 and the Ammonoosuc River in the southwestern corner of the town.

    Lisbon was first granted in 1763 by Colonial Governor Benning Wentworth as "Concord". In 1764 the town was renamed "Chiswick", after the Duke of Devonshire's castle, while Rumford in central New Hampshire took the name "Concord" in 1765. In 1768, the town was settled and renamed again, this time to "Gunthwaite", after a relation of Colonial Governor John Wentworth. The name "Lisbon" was selected by Governor Levi Woodbury when it was incorporated in 1824. His friend, Colonel William Jarvis, had been consul at Lisbon, Portugal. The town once included land that is now part of Littleton and Sugar Hill.

    Charcoal-making was an early industry. Iron, gold and other minerals were mined here. The narrow, steep falls of the Ammonoosuc River provided water power for numerous watermills and factories, and the Parker Young Company was at one time the largest manufacturer of piano sounding boards in the world. Lisbon was the site of the first rope ski tow in New Hampshire.
